Icebreaker Toolkit: Simple Openers That Actually Work
Feeling unsure what to say is normal — skip the anxiety and try easy, adaptable openers that invite a reply without sounding generic. Start by scanning their profile for one small, specific detail and use one of these patterns to build a natural first message.
- Observation + question: "I noticed your photo at the coast — do you prefer sunrise or sunset there?" This shows you looked and gives a low-pressure choice to respond to.
- Curiosity + two options: "You mention cooking — pasta night or taco night this week?" Two clear options make replying simple and even a little playful.
- Short compliment + follow-up: "Nice hiking shot — what trail was that?" Keep compliments concrete and tie them to a question so it doesn’t feel like a line.
- Light callback to their words: If they wrote "bookworm," try: "Bookworm here too — what’s one book you’d recommend to someone who only reads thrillers?" A callback feels personal without being intense.
- Shared small talk starter: "I’m debating my next weekend plan: coffee shop with a good playlist or a park walk. What would you pick?" Low stakes and relatable.
How to avoid coming off boring, weird, or canned:
- Skip generic openers: Avoid “Hey” or “What’s up?” on their own—follow them with context or a question.
- Don’t overdo praise: A single, specific compliment beats vague flattery. Mention the detail, not the person’s looks or entire personality.
- Keep it short and specific: Long messages can feel heavy. One or two sentences with a clear question invite faster replies.
- Don’t interrogate: Avoid a rapid list of personal questions. Aim for one question that naturally leads to another if the conversation flows.
Quick templates you can tweak:
- "I saw [detail] — what’s the story behind that?"
- "You like [hobby]. Do you have a favorite place to do that around here?"
- "I’m torn between [option A] and [option B]. Which would you choose?"
- "You mentioned [interest]. I tried that once — any beginner tips?"
